        경추 골절 및 탈구의 관혈적 정복술 직후 발생한 사지마비 - 1례 보고 -

        박동성,성병년,박찬지 대한골절학회 1999 대한골절학회지 Vol.12 No.3

        Open reduction and internal fixation of the cervical spine is a commonly performed method of treatment for acute cervical fracture dislocation. A sudden or gradual worsening of the neurological status of a patient during reduction should alert the physician to the presence of high grade compression of the spinal canal. Loss of neurological function during or after manipulation or open reduction and internal fixation should raise the suspicion of compression of the spinal cord from a lesion occupying the canal, such as a herniated disc, buckling of the ligamentum flavum, an epidural hematoma or bone fragments. Magnetic resonance imaging or myelogram are the most helpful diagnostic means and should be used initially if suspected. Treatment is anterior decompression and autogenous strut bone graft. Causes of our case include ruptured disc, vertebral end plate and posterior longitudinal ligament We experienced a case of immediate quadriparesis after posterior decompression and sublaminar wiring for cervical fracture dislocation which was resulted from ruptured disc, vertebral end plate and posterior longitudinal ligament.

        세 가지 역충전재의 근단부 폐쇄 효과에 관한 전기화학적 연구

        박동성,손서진,오태석,유현미,박찬제,임순호,이영규,계승범 대한치과보존학회 2004 Restorative Dentistry & Endodontics Vol.29 No.4

        The purpose of this study was to evaluate the apical sealing ability of Super-EBA, MTA and Dyract-flow as retrofilling materials. Forty-eight extracted human teeth with straight and single root canal were used in this study. The root canals were prepared to a #40 apical canal size and obturated with gutter-percha. Apicoectomies were performed and root end cavities were prepared to a depth of 3mm using an ultrasonic device. The root end cavities were filled with Super-EBA, MTA or Dyract-flow. Leakage was measured using an electrochemical technique for 4 weeks. According to this study, the results were as follows. 1. Increasing leakage with time was observed in all groups. 2. No significant difference was noted among the 3 groups with time (p = 0.216). 3. No significant difference was noted among the 3 groups when measured within the same time interval (p = 0.814). The results of this study suggest that the sealing ability of Dyract-flow is equal to that of Super-EBA and MTA, and Dyract-flow may be an alternative to other materials for root-end filling. . 본 연구의 목적은 Super-EBA, MTA, Dyract-flow를 근관 역충전재로 사용하였을 때의 근단부 폐쇄 능력을 전기화학적 방법을 통해 알아보고자 하는 것이다. 48개의 단근치를 Profile을 사용하여 근관형성한 후, Gutter-percha cone으로 수직가압 충전을 시행하였다. 근단부에서 3mm 되는 부위를 bur로 절단한 후, ultrasonic device로 3mm 깊이의 역충전 와동을 형성하였다. 각 실험군은 Super-EBA, MTA, 혹은 Dyract-flow로 역충전하고 4주에 걸쳐 전기화학적인 방법으로 치근단 누출의 변화를 측정한 후, Repeated measures of ANOVA로 통계분석하였다. 그 결과 모든 시편에서 시간에 따른 치근단 누출의 증가가 관찰되었으나, 각 실험군 간에 누출의 차이는 나타나지 않았다. 이러한 결과는 Dyract-flow의 치근단 역충전재로써의 사용 가능성을 시사한다.

        멀티미디어 응용을 위한 수송 계층에서의 유연한 오류 제어 모델

        박동성,이상헌,고봉홍,이재용,이상배 한국통신학회 1996 韓國通信學會論文誌 Vol.21 No.4

        미래의 멀티미디어 응용 환경은 각 매체와 응용의 요구 사항들을 효율적으로 충족시킬 수 있는 유연한 오류 제어 모델을 필요로 하고 있으나, 지금까지의 오류 제어는 단일 매체를 처리하기 위한 제한된 유연성만이 제공되어왔다. 이를 해결하기 위하여 본 논문에서는 매체의 신뢰도 기준인 오류 허용률(ETL: Error Tolerance Level)과 응용의 실시간성 기준인 지연(Delay)을 고려하여 수송 계층에서 매체별로 유연하게 오류 제어 방법을 적용하는 모델을 제안한다. 이 모델에서는 매체별로 오류 제어 방법을 선정하기 위하여 오류 혀용률과 등시성과 같은 매체의 속성, 응용의 속성인 지연, 그리고 망에서의 데이터 손실율, 망의 전송 형태, 응용의 연결 모드와 같은 환경 파라미터가 영향 인자로써 고려되었다. Emerging service classes need an error model which efficiently satisfies the requirements for each media and application. However limited flexibility in the error control has been provided. Therefore we propose a new error control model which applies error control scheme per media flexibly with respect to ETL(Error Tolerance Leverl) and delay. In order to select the error control scheme in this model, the attributes of media(i.e., ETL, isochronism), the attributes of application(i.e., delay) and environment parameters(i.e., packet loss ration, network types, connection modes of the application) are considered as effect factors.

        저출력 레이저가 기계적 노출치수에 미치는 영향에 관한 연구

        박동성,임성삼,Park, Dong-Sung,Lim, Sung-Sam 대한치과보존학회 1989 Restorative Dentistry & Endodontics Vol.14 No.1

        The purpose of this study was to investigate the bio-stimulating effect of low power density laser radiation on the mechanically exposed pulp. Class V cavities on dog's teeth were prepared and the pulps were mechanically exposed with a round bur. In control group, the exposed pulps were capped with $Ca(OH)_2$ powder and the cavities were sealed with Z.O.E.. In experimental group A, the pulps were irradiated with GaA1As laser for 5 minutes and then they were treated the same as control group. In experimental group B, the exposed pulps were covered by aluminum foil and sealed with Z.O.E. after they were irradiated with the laser as the experimental group A. In the all groups, the pulps were histopathologically observed at the time intervals of 1, 2 and 3 week after experiment and the results were statistically evaluated. The results were as follows: 1) In control and experimental groups, mild vascular congestion and bleeding was found in most of the specimens and for the new formation of dentin bridge, experimental group A had the most cases. The dentin bridge had discontinuous osteodentin like appearance without any dentinal tubules. Inflammatory cell infiltration consisted of acute and chronic inflammatory cell, and the formation of microabscess was also observed. 2) The degree of inflammatory cell infiltration was not significantly different among control group and experimental groups at 1 week, 2 week and 3 week. 3) The formation of new dentin bridge was not significantly different between control group and experimental group A at 1 week, but at 2 week and 3 week, experimental group A showed significantly more cases of new dentin formation than control groups. (P < 0.05). 4) Between control group and experimental group B, there was no significant difference in formation of the new dentin bridge at 1, 2 and 3 week. (P> 0.05). 5) There was no significant difference in formation of the new dentin bridge at 1 and 2 week between experimental group A and experimental group B, but at 3 week, the former significantly had more cases of new dentin bridge formation than the latter.(P < 0.05).

        일본 나가노현 노자와온센 지역의 온천공유자원 관리방식에 관한 연구

        박동성 한국문화인류학회 2017 韓國文化人類學 Vol.50 No.3

        In the Japanese community, traditional CPRs (common pool resources or commons) have been managed by the Irai group. An important feature of these commons is that they have maintained a long–term autonomous management system and that the traditional way continues to be maintained. The hot springs and forests, which occupy most of the commons of Nozawa Onsen Village, were transferred to the traditional village before the regional merger in the late 19th century. At that time, forests that were organized as traditional villages were converted into the property of the residents, and were not transferred to local governments through the subsequent reform of the local system, remaining in the possession of the Irii group. This phenomenon is found all over Japan. Because the common law is more dominant than the modern civil law in the management of these commons, the traditional organization of the community enables the role of strong governance. This paper examines the history and current status of traditional organizations in a Japanese community in pursuit of endogenous development through community practice with residents and local governments. 일본의 지역사회에는 지역공동체가 관리하는 전통적인 공유자원이 존재해 왔다. 이들 공유자원의 중요한 특징은 자치적 관리방식을 오랜 기간 동안 지속해 왔으며 오늘날에도 전통적인 방식이 유지된다는 점이다. 노자와온센무라의 공유재산의 대부분을 차지하는 온천과 임야는 19세기 말 지역합병 이전의 자연촌 단위에 연원한다. 당시 새로운 행정 구역으로 재산을 이전하지 않고 자연촌을단위로 재산구를 구성하거나 주민의 공유로 전환된 재산은 이후의 지방제도 개혁을 통해서도 지역 집단의 소유로 남았다. 이런 현상은 일본 전국에 걸쳐서 발견된다. 이러한 공유자원의 관리에는 근대적 민법보다 관습법이 우선시되기 때문에 지역사회의 전통조직이 관리의주체가 된다. 이 논문에서는 한 지역사회의 전통조직에서 이루어지는 공유자원 관리방식의실천을 통하여 공동체의 구체적 모습을 드러내 보이고자 한다.
